Job description

Position Summary

The Custodial Technician is part of Vanderbilt University Maintenance and Operations (VUMO) and is an individual contributor responsible for performing specialized housekeeping and cleaning duties in various buildings across the Vanderbilt University campus. This position reports directly to the Housekeeping Supervisor and works in partnership with all departments across the university.

VUMO provides facilities support for all construction, renovation, and routine maintenance of University Central space and facilities; housekeeping services for approximately 5.8 million square feet of academic, administrative, residential, and recreational space; grounds care for 330 acres that are a registered arboretum; turf care for athletic fields; and utilities for the University Central and the Medical Center.

The Custodial Technician role is assigned to perform higher level and more specialized custodial duties throughout the Vanderbilt University campus.
